On Mon, 14 Sep 1998, David Faure wrote:

> Yes, make dist is broken with current automake/autoconf.
> I suggest not using it all, but instead : make a copy of your devel
> tree, make, make distclean, remove any *~, #*#, CVS or any other
> things you don't want (find and |xargs rm can be useful), then tar the 
> thing. I've been doing it like that for 1 year now, for ktalkd.

.cvsignore and .deps should also be removed.

I really hate to see distfiles including config.cache and .deps depending
on /opt/somestrangepath/include/someheader.h

:)

Btw.. why doesn't make distclean remove .deps?
